Would anyone be able to recommend a supplier of quality water stones (e.g. Shapton) that could deliver to the UK?  I've been struggling to find anything online, it seems odd that sites sell high quality Japanese knives that should be sharpened with a whetstone but don't sell anything appropriate!

I use a King (1000/6000) combination stone (at about 20 quid a pop from http://www.axminster.co.uk ) for both western and hocho knives - good value, I thought.

If you're a bit more descerning (than I) try http://www.fine-tools.com/japwas.htm
